Update demo's with images in them
This commit is contained in:
parent
bd48279227
commit
010e0f0d62
@ -51,5 +51,8 @@
|
||||
#define GDISP_NEED_IMAGE_JPG FALSE
|
||||
#define GDISP_NEED_IMAGE_PNG FALSE
|
||||
|
||||
#define GFX_USE_GFILE TRUE
|
||||
#define GFILE_NEED_MEMFS TRUE
|
||||
|
||||
#endif /* _GFXCONF_H */
|
||||
|
||||
|
@ -53,12 +53,11 @@ int main(void) {
|
||||
|
||||
// Set up IO for our image
|
||||
#if USE_MEMORY_FILE
|
||||
gdispImageSetMemoryReader(&myImage, test_pal8);
|
||||
gdispImageOpenMemory(&myImage, test_pal8);
|
||||
#else
|
||||
gdispImageSetSimulFileReader(&myImage, "test-pal8.bmp");
|
||||
gdispImageOpenFile(&myImage, "test-pal8.bmp");
|
||||
#endif
|
||||
|
||||
gdispImageOpen(&myImage);
|
||||
gdispImageDraw(&myImage, 0, 0, swidth, sheight, 0, 0);
|
||||
gdispImageClose(&myImage);
|
||||
|
||||
|
@ -51,5 +51,8 @@
|
||||
#define GDISP_NEED_IMAGE_JPG FALSE
|
||||
#define GDISP_NEED_IMAGE_PNG FALSE
|
||||
|
||||
#define GFX_USE_GFILE TRUE
|
||||
#define GFILE_NEED_MEMFS TRUE
|
||||
|
||||
#endif /* _GFXCONF_H */
|
||||
|
||||
|
@ -76,12 +76,11 @@ int main(void) {
|
||||
|
||||
// Set up IO for our image
|
||||
#if USE_MEMORY_FILE
|
||||
gdispImageSetMemoryReader(&myImage, testanim);
|
||||
if (!(gdispImageOpenMemory(&myImage, testanim) & GDISP_IMAGE_ERR_UNRECOVERABLE)) {
|
||||
#else
|
||||
gdispImageSetFileReader(&myImage, "testanim.gif");
|
||||
if (!(gdispImageOpenFile(&myImage, "testanim.gif") & GDISP_IMAGE_ERR_UNRECOVERABLE)) {
|
||||
#endif
|
||||
|
||||
if (gdispImageOpen(&myImage) == GDISP_IMAGE_ERR_OK) {
|
||||
gdispImageSetBgColor(&myImage, MY_BG_COLOR);
|
||||
// Adjust the error indicator area if necessary
|
||||
if (myImage.width > errx && myImage.height < sheight) {
|
||||
|
@ -79,6 +79,10 @@
|
||||
#define GWIN_NEED_RADIO TRUE
|
||||
#define GWIN_NEED_LIST TRUE
|
||||
|
||||
/* Features for the GFILE subsystem. */
|
||||
#define GFX_USE_GFILE TRUE
|
||||
#define GFILE_NEED_MEMFS TRUE
|
||||
|
||||
/* Features for the GINPUT subsystem. */
|
||||
#define GINPUT_NEED_MOUSE TRUE
|
||||
|
||||
|
@ -184,8 +184,7 @@ static void createWidgets(void) {
|
||||
wi.g.x = 0+2*(LIST_WIDTH+1); wi.text = "L3"; ghList3 = gwinListCreate(0, &wi, TRUE);
|
||||
gwinListAddItem(ghList3, "Item 0", FALSE); gwinListAddItem(ghList3, "Item 1", FALSE);
|
||||
gwinListAddItem(ghList3, "Item 2", FALSE); gwinListAddItem(ghList3, "Item 3", FALSE);
|
||||
gdispImageSetMemoryReader(&imgYesNo, image_yesno);
|
||||
gdispImageOpen(&imgYesNo);
|
||||
gdispImageOpenMemory(&imgYesNo, image_yesno);
|
||||
gwinListItemSetImage(ghList3, 1, &imgYesNo);
|
||||
gwinListItemSetImage(ghList3, 3, &imgYesNo);
|
||||
|
||||
|
Loading…
Reference in New Issue
Block a user